Heads up for on-call: the Pinefold transcode farm is running hot this week thanks to the Marlowe launch backlog. If queue depth climbs past the ceiling, scale the worker pool before touching priorities. The knobs below are what autoscaling reads at startup, so a restart is needed after edits.

tuning constants:
RATE_LIMITS = {
    "goriel": 284,
    "brieth": 236,
    "lamvan": 916,
    "druok": 255,
    "wenion": 979,
    "istmir": 343,
    "queniel": 302,
}

## Sweeper: orphaned resources

The Drossbin sweeper runs hourly on the Karstway cluster. It tags volumes, snapshots, and load balancers with no owning stack, waits one grace cycle, then deletes. If it stalls, check the lease lock first — a stuck lease blocks all runs. Kill the lease, restart the pod, confirm the next cycle completes. Config lives in `sweeper.env`: region, grace period, dry-run flag. The sweeper authenticates to the Karstway control plane with a service credential, set on the line directly after those entries.

env line for fafof-fahag: LEDGER_TOKEN5=f8790

Partitioning `shipment_events` by month looks right, but the retention and pre-create logic should not hardcode intervals inline. On the Verdane warehouse cluster we learned that creating partitions lazily at insert time causes lock contention at month rollover, so please pre-create ahead of time via the maintenance job. Also, dropping old partitions should lag retention by a grace period in case Brimsport analytics needs a backfill. Suggest pulling these into module-level constants as follows.

tuning constants:
QUOTAS = {
    "druwyn": 5,
    "holix": 5,
    "zorath": 5,
    "holwyn": 10,
}

## Idempotency Keys for Payment Retries (Lumopay)

Every retry of a charge request must reuse the original idempotency key; generating a new key on retry can produce duplicate charges. Keys are scoped per merchant and expire after 48 hours. Reviewers should verify keys are derived server-side, never from client input. The full key-generation specification and threat model are maintained on the internal page.

dashboard of kaguf-tawip = https://vault.merlaqsys.test/issue